Specht Sets 400m Freestyle World Record

In case there should be any thoughts of Bill Specht’s early retirement from recording breaking, he broke the world record for the 400m freestyle (short-course) for men 40-44 at a Masters meet in Orlando last weekend, reports his coach, George Bole.

His time, 4:09.10, just edged Hess Yntema’s listed world and American mark of 4:09.86.
